From eea8032f0db1881961095802c4242fa7c0e2a232 Mon Sep 17 00:00:00 2001 From: roymondchen Date: Tue, 21 Nov 2023 11:34:33 +0800 Subject: [PATCH] =?UTF-8?q?fix(dep):=20=E6=95=B0=E6=8D=AE=E6=BA=90?= =?UTF-8?q?=E4=BE=9D=E8=B5=96=E6=94=B6=E9=9B=86=E4=B8=8D=E6=94=B6=E9=9B=86?= =?UTF-8?q?=E5=8D=95=E7=8B=AC=E7=9A=84id=EF=BC=8C=E5=9B=A0=E4=B8=BAid?= =?UTF-8?q?=E4=B8=8D=E9=9C=80=E8=A6=81=E7=BC=96=E8=AF=91?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- packages/dep/src/utils.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/packages/dep/src/utils.ts b/packages/dep/src/utils.ts index 94d9caf4..13804c42 100644 --- a/packages/dep/src/utils.ts +++ b/packages/dep/src/utils.ts @@ -41,7 +41,7 @@ export const createDataSourceTarget = (ds: DataSourceSchema, initialDeps: DepDat // 或者在模板在使用数据源,如:`xxx${id.field}xxx` if ( (value?.isBindDataSource && value.dataSourceId) || - (typeof value === 'string' && value.includes(`${ds.id}`)) + (typeof value === 'string' && value.includes(`${ds.id}`) && /\$\{([\s\S]+?)\}/.test(value)) ) { return true; }